簡體   English   中英

FHIR:我是否需要為所有資源設置 StructureDefinition?

[英]FHIR: do I need to have StructureDefinition for all the resources?

FHIR 一致性層包括StructureDefinition資源,當我的服務器沒有任何自定義資源時,我試圖了解是否必須在那里提供任何東西?

我們將支持多個實施指南(例如 US Core 和 CarinBB),它們有自己的配置文件和擴展。 但是他們所有的 StructureDefinitions 已經在hl7.org上定義了,我可以從我的 CapabilityStatement 和實例中獲得指向這些配置文件的鏈接。 那么我需要在我的服務器上公開這些結構定義嗎?

或者它應該是空的,因為我沒有任何習慣?

您的 CapabiltyStatement應該為您支持的每個資源聲明一個 StructureDefinition,表明您的實際系統功能是什么 - 即您可以實際使用或產生哪些數據。 通常,這將涉及各種配置文件的期望以及一些其他內容的組合。 您可能對重復有限制,您可能不支持某些配置文件中的某些可選元素,並且可能支持一些配置文件都不期望支持的其他元素或擴展。 很少有實現具有與官方發布的配置文件完全匹配的內部支持。 但是,如果您這樣做,從技術上講,您可以指向該官方個人資料,而不是創建自己的個人資料。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M